Output d336398096af121b2f19b65dd18f1319d88c24f1b8c17410a53d239d83363538:6

value
2481000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ea0becfa36a01a513242a50398b6dc9aed4e96 OP_EQUAL
address
36hNnk8Pj1VdwyYy2GeKuh8nQatF8dosL7
transaction
d336398096af121b2f19b65dd18f1319d88c24f1b8c17410a53d239d83363538
spent
true